snowfall
The falling of snow from the clouds as a meteorological event.
Der Wetterbericht hat für die Nacht starken Schneefall angekündigt.
The weather forecast announced heavy snowfall for the night.

The word is a clear compound of 'der Schnee' (snow) and 'der Fall' (fall). Here, 'Fall' comes from the verb 'fallen' (to fall). So it literally describes the falling of snow.
Kinder freuen sich immer über den ersten Schneefall im Winter.
Children are always happy about the first snowfall in winter.
'Schneefall' (snowfall) is very often combined with adjectives that describe its intensity. Typical phrases are 'starker' (heavy), 'leichter' (light), 'heftiger' (severe/heavy), or 'plötzlicher' (sudden) snowfall.
Wegen des plötzlichen, starken Schneefalls kam es zu langen Staus.
Because of the sudden, heavy snowfall, there were long traffic jams.
To express a reason, 'Schneefall' (snowfall) is frequently used with the preposition 'wegen' (because of) and the genitive. This is typical in news reports or official announcements.
Wegen des anhaltenden Schneefalls bleiben die Schulen morgen geschlossen.
Because of the ongoing snowfall, schools will remain closed tomorrow.
snow
'Schnee' and 'Schneefall' are closely related, but they do not mean exactly the same thing. 'Schnee' is the material itself: the white flakes in the air or the white layer on the ground. 'Schneefall' mainly means the process of snow falling from the clouds, or the amount of snow that has fallen in a period of time. Learners may confuse the words because both are used when talking about the weather. In practical terms: you see Schnee on the street, but in the weather forecast people often talk about Schneefall.

Am Abend wurde der Schneefall stärker, und viele Züge hatten Verspätung.
In the evening, the snowfall became heavier, and many trains were delayed.
Auf dem Parkplatz liegt so viel Schnee, dass die Autos kaum herauskommen.
There is so much snow in the parking lot that the cars can hardly get out.
